Over the last 7 days, the Consumer Staples industry has remained flat, although notably Miwa Sugar declined by 3.6%. Furthermore, the industry has been flat for the past year as well. In the next few years, earnings are forecast to decline by 1.1% annually.

Current Industry PE
  • Investors are pessimistic on the Mauritian Consumer Staples industry, indicating that they anticipate long term growth rates will be lower than they have historically.
  • The industry is trading at a PE ratio of 5.9x which is lower than its 3-year average PE of 13.9x.
  • The industry is trading close to its 3-year average PS ratio of 0.69x.
Past Earnings Growth
  • The earnings for companies in the Consumer Staples industry have grown 66% per year over the last three years.
  • Revenues for these companies have grown 8.0% per year.
  • This means that more sales are being generated by these companies overall, and subsequently their profits are increasing too.

Industry PE
  • Investors are most optimistic about the Personal Products industry which is trading above its 3-year average PE ratio.
    • It looks like they are confident that earnings will grow faster in the future than they have historically.
  • Investors are most pessimistic about the Food industry, which is trading below its 3-year average of 14.9x.
Forecasted Growth
  • Despite it being negative, analysts are least pessimistic on the Beverage industry since they expect its earnings to decline by only 1.1% per year over the next 5 years, which isn't as bad as the other industries.
  • This is a reversal from its past annual earnings growth rate of 99% per year.
  • In contrast, the Beverage industry is expected to see its earnings growth to stay flat over the next few years.
